Death Sentence of Zohair Shamsi Carried Out in Ahvaz Central Prison

Breathing in Confinement – On the morning of Saturday, 5 April 2025, the death sentence of at least one prisoner, convicted of murder, was carried out in Ahvaz Prison.

According to Breathing in Confinement, the news outlet of the Prisoners’ Rights League in Iran, one prisoner was executed at Sepidar Prison in Ahvaz early on Saturday, 5 April 2025. The identity of the prisoner has been confirmed as Zohair Shamsi.

According to the report by Breathing in Confinement, Zohair Shamsi, a married labourer from Dezful, was arrested four years ago on charges of murdering his cousin and was sentenced to death. The execution was carried out at dawn on Saturday, 5 April 2025, in Sepidar Prison, Ahvaz.

No official report

As of the time of this report, the execution of this prisoner has not been announced by official resources.

Annual Report on Executions in Iran

According to the annual report by the Statistics Centre of the Prisoners’ Rights League in Iran, at least 1,170 individuals were executed in Iran in 2024. Among them, five people were executed in public, and the executed also included 38 women and 9 juvenile offenders.
